Evaluating Used Pickup Trucks: Key Factors to Consider

When looking for the best deals on used pickup trucks, evaluating potential purchases requires a methodical approach. To ensure you select affordable long wheel base pickups that meet your needs—whether for rugged terrain or family transportation—it’s crucial to assess several key factors. Start by examining the vehicle’s overall condition, including its service history and any prior accidents or damage. Reputable dealers often provide detailed maintenance records, which can offer valuable insights into the truck’s care and potential future reliability.
Next, consider the specific make and model, as different brands excel in various areas. For instance, some manufacturers are renowned for their robust engines suitable for rugged terrain, while others focus on family-friendly amenities and comfort. Best pickup trucks for rugged terrain often feature powerful V8 engines, four-wheel drive systems, and advanced off-road capabilities. Conversely, best pickup trucks for families may prioritize spacious interiors with ample storage space, advanced safety features, and fuel efficiency.
Mileage is another critical factor. Generally, lower mileage indicates better preservation of the truck’s components, potentially leading to fewer maintenance issues down the line. However, it’s essential not to solely base your decision on mileage alone; instead, consider it in conjunction with the vehicle’s history and overall condition. According to industry data, pickup trucks with between 50,000 and 100,000 miles often represent a sweet spot, offering a balance between affordability and reliability.
Lastly, test driving is indispensable. During the drive, pay close attention to handling, braking, and engine performance. Check for any unusual noises or vibrations that could indicate underlying mechanical issues. Finding Reliable Sources for Best Deals on Pickups

Finding reliable sources for best deals on pickup trucks is a crucial step in securing a quality pre-owned vehicle without breaking the bank. One of the key metrics to consider is the resale value, as it indicates the long-term reliability and demand for specific models. According to recent data, pickup trucks with best resale value often include top 10 best-selling models like the Ford F-150, Chevrolet Silverado, and Ram 1500. These not only retain their value over time but also offer robust performance and advanced features, making them excellent choices for used truck buyers.
When navigating the market for highest rated used full size pickups, it’s essential to consult reputable dealers and online platforms known for their rigorous inspection processes. Websites like CarMax, AutoNation, and specialized pickup truck dealerships often have a vast inventory of pre-owned vehicles that have undergone thorough checks. These sources not only provide peace of mind but also offer competitive pricing on top-rated models, ensuring buyers get the best deals available. For instance, the 2018-2020 Ford F-150 and Ram 1500 models consistently rank high in resale value and customer satisfaction surveys, making them excellent candidates for those seeking reliable used pickup trucks.
In addition to established dealers, online classifieds and dedicated automotive forums can be goldmines for finding exceptional deals on select pickup trucks. Websites like Craigslist, Autotrader, and CarGurus allow buyers to access a diverse range of vehicles, often at lower prices than traditional dealerships. However, caution is advised when purchasing from private sellers or online platforms. Thorough research, cross-referencing with industry standards, and independent inspections are crucial to avoid buying a vehicle with hidden issues. For example, a 2017 Chevrolet Silverado with low mileage could be an excellent find, but it’s essential to verify its maintenance history and overall condition before making a purchase.

Understanding Your Needs Before Select Pickup Trucks

Before diving into the best deals on used pickup trucks, it’s crucial to understand your specific needs. The market offers a diverse range of options, from powerful machines designed for off-roading to family-friendly models with ample passenger and cargo space. Defining your priorities upfront ensures you select the ideal pickup truck—one that delivers exactly what you require without overdelivering features you don’t need.
Consider, for instance, the best used pickup trucks for off-roading. If rugged terrain is your primary concern, look for models with high ground clearance, robust 4×4 systems, and capable towing capabilities. Brands like Ford (F-150) and Jeep (Wrangler) offer excellent options in this category, with many affordable pre-owned models available that still pack a punch. Conversely, if you’re seeking the best pickup trucks for families, safety features, interior comfort, and spacious cabins become paramount. Truck manufacturers have significantly enhanced passenger protection with adv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S), making modern family pickups safer than ever before.
Affordability is another key factor. Long wheel base pickups can be particularly useful for businesses or those needing extra cargo space. Luckily, many used models offer excellent value in this segment, providing both functionality and savings. For example, a 2018-2020 Ford F-150 XLT with a V6 engine, extended cab, and long bed can be found within a reasonable budget, striking a balance between capability and cost. Researching specific models, their known reliability, and common maintenance costs will empower you to make an informed decision when selecting your used pickup truck.
Inspection and Test Drive: Ensuring Quality Purchases

When shopping for used pickup trucks, one of the most crucial steps in ensuring a quality purchase is conducting thorough inspections and test drives. This process goes beyond simply checking the exterior and interior conditions; it involves assessing the vehicle’s mechanical soundness, performance capabilities, and advanced safety features that are increasingly standard in modern pick-ups. Start by examining the truck’s undercarriage for signs of rust or previous repairs. Full-size pickup trucks, given their size and versatility, often face varied driving conditions, so checking for any structural damage is essential.
During the test drive, focus on how the truck handles on various terrains, including twists and turns, as well as its responsiveness to acceleration and braking. Modern pickup trucks are designed to be road trip ready, equipped with powerful engines and advanced driver aids like adaptive cruise control, lane-keeping assist, and automatic emergency braking. These features not only enhance safety but also contribute to a smoother driving experience, especially on longer journeys. Consider test driving models known for their reliability in this regard, such as the Ford F-150 or the Chevrolet Silverado 1500, which offer a vibrant selection of full-size pick-ups with robust options for road trip accessories.
Additionally, pay attention to the truck’s comfort and convenience features, especially if you plan to use it for daily commuting or hauling heavy loads. Pickup trucks with advanced driver aids can make these tasks easier by providing enhanced visibility, stability control, and smart towing systems that allow for safer and more efficient hauling. Keep in mind that data from reputable sources can help you compare different models’ safety ratings and performance metrics before committing to a purchase.
